The most valuable thing you can offer a student who reaches 99% of their weekly target is to insist they finish. Not out of indifference, but because you know they're capable of completing it—and that lowering the standard is the true failure.
You are not a classroom teacher. At Alpha, students master academic content through AI-driven adaptive learning applications. No traditional lectures. No printed textbooks. No instruction at the whiteboard. Motivation and essential life skills—the two elements conventional schools typically relegate to the sidelines—become your entire focus here.
Imagine a typical Tuesday. You spend half the day facilitating one-hour workshops for a K-8 group, covering topics like public speaking, maintaining focus, and exchanging constructive feedback. The remaining half is devoted to working with these same students individually or in small groups, reviewing their Coachbot data, and driving each one toward 100% completion of their weekly app targets—leveraging school currency, leaderboards, and the trust you've established to overcome obstacles.
Your quarterly performance hinges on three metrics: all students in your cohort complete their weekly app goals, all students pass the Test2
Pass mastery verification for each workshop, and 90% or higher report that they love you. Fall short on any one of these, and you've missed the mark.
The reward comes the day a student who insisted in September that they were terrible at math asks you to increase their goal.
